Chae Hom (Thai: แจ้ห่ม; IPA: [tɕɛ̂ː hòm]) is a district (amphoe) of Lampang Province, northern Thailand.
Neighboring districts are (from the north clockwise): Wang Nuea, Ngao, Mae Mo, Mueang Lampang and Mueang Pan of Lampang Province.
The district is subdivided into 7 subdistricts (tambon), which are further subdivided into 58 villages (muban). Chae Hom is a township (thesaban tambon) which covers parts of tambon Chae Hom. There are further 7 Tambon administrative organizations (TAO).
